When Is Faucet Replacement Necessary?

Some faucet problems can be repaired, while others are better solved with replacement. A small leak may come from a worn washer, seal, cartridge, or connection. However, if the faucet is old, corroded, loose, cracked, or repeatedly leaking after repairs, replacement may be the smarter option.

Homeowners may need faucet replacement when they notice constant dripping, rust around the base, low water pressure, difficulty turning handles, water pooling under the sink, or mineral buildup that keeps returning. A faucet that looks outdated or no longer matches the style of the room may also be worth replacing during a kitchen or bathroom update.

Kitchen Sink Faucet Repair and Replacement

The kitchen faucet is one of the hardest-working fixtures in the home. It is used for cooking, cleaning, washing dishes, filling pots, and rinsing produce. Because it gets so much daily use, problems with the kitchen faucet can interrupt the entire household routine.

Kitchen sink faucet repair may be needed if the faucet leaks around the handle, drips from the spout, has poor pressure, or sprays unevenly. Sometimes the issue is inside the faucet itself, while other times it may involve the supply lines or connections beneath the sink.

If repair is no longer practical, a professional plumber can install a new faucet that fits your sink and plumbing setup. Modern kitchen faucets come in many styles, including pull-down sprayers, touchless models, single-handle designs, and high-arc faucets. A trained faucet installer can make sure everything is connected securely, sealed properly, and tested before the job is finished.

Don’t Forget About Outdoor Faucets

Outdoor faucets are easy to overlook until there is a leak, broken handle, or water flow issue. These faucets are used for garden hoses, lawn care, cleaning patios, washing vehicles, and other outdoor tasks. When an exterior faucet leaks, it can waste water and create muddy areas near the foundation.

Outdoor faucets may become damaged from weather exposure, age, corrosion, or loose connections. If you notice dripping, spraying, or trouble shutting off the water completely, Mr. Rooter Plumbing can inspect the fixture and recommend repair or replacement.

Why Hire a Professional Faucet Installer?

Faucet installation may look simple, but small mistakes can cause big problems. A loose connection, improper seal, wrong fitting, or mismatched fixture can lead to leaks under the sink or behind the wall. These leaks may go unnoticed until they cause cabinet damage, mold concerns, or higher water bills.

Hiring a professional plumber helps ensure that the faucet is installed correctly the first time. Benefits of a New Faucet

Replacing an old faucet can improve both appearance and performance. A new faucet can make a sink easier to use, reduce dripping, improve water flow, and update the look of the room. In kitchens, newer faucets can add helpful features such as pull-down sprayers or easier temperature control. In bathrooms, replacement can make the vanity look cleaner and more modern.

A new faucet can also help reduce water waste when the old fixture has been leaking for weeks or months. Even a slow drip can waste a surprising amount of water over time.

Why is my faucet leaking? 

A leaking faucet is often due to worn-out washers, O-rings, or seals within the faucet assembly. While these issues can usually be fixed with simple repairs, ignoring them can lead to higher water bills and further damage over time.

How long do water heaters typically last? 

The average lifespan of a water heater is 8 to 12 years. Maintenance tasks like flushing your tank and checking the anode rod will help to extend its life.

What should I do if I smell some gas near my water heater? 

If you smell any gas near your water heater, it’s important to leave the area immediately and contact your emergency services and your gas company. Don't try to fix a gas leak on your own, because it can be extremely dangerous.

How do I know if my sump pump is working properly? 

To ensure your sump pump is functioning, test it by pouring some water into the sump pit. The pump should activate and remove the water. Regular maintenance checks, especially before rainy seasons, can prevent malfunctions when you need the pump most.

Are there any benefits to routine drain cleaning? 

Regular drain cleaning prevents clogs, reduces foul odors, and maintains the health of your plumbing system. It can also extend the lifespan of your pipes and help prevent unexpected plumbing emergencies.
